Sandra Wilson Obituary

Sandra Sue Wilson, 81, of Haubstadt, IN, passed away at Linda E. White Hospice House in Evansville, IN, on Sunday, April 21, 2024. She was born to the late Ralph and Stella (DeLong) Boyle on December 2, 1942, in Princeton, IN.

Sue most recently attended St. Stephen United Church of Christ. She graduated from Fort Branch High School and married her loving husband, Melvin Wilson on November 28, 1963. 

Besides her parents, she is preceded in death by her husband of 55 years, Melvin Wilson; son, David Wilson; siblings, Norma Pharo, Bob Boyles, Gene Boyle and an infant sister; and nephew, Bobby Boyles.

Sue is survived by her son, Daniel (Hope) Wilson; grandchildren, Chastity (Travis) Curtis and Jourdan Wilson; great grandchildren, Olivia and Garrett Curtis; and nephews, Doug Boyle and Greg Boyle.

A Celebration of life will be held on Friday, April 26, 2024, at 1:00 p.m. at Stodghill Funeral Home with Pastor Brian Pullum officiating. The burial will be at Asbury Cemetery in Omaha, IL, following services. Visitation will be on Friday, April 26, 2024, from 12:00 p.m. until service time at the funeral home. In lieu of flowers, donations can be made to the Linda E. White Hospice House in Evansville, IN. Expressions of sympathy can be made at stodghillfuneralhome.com.
